Understanding Headphone Prices: A Comprehensive Guide
In the ever-evolving landscape of audio technology, headphones have actually ended up being a necessary accessory for music lovers, players, and specialists. They can be found in various designs, each with unique features accommodating different requirements and preferences. Nevertheless, among the most critical aspects that affect a customer's choice is price. This article intends to explore the aspects influencing headphone costs, offer insights on prices tiers, and provide a list of popular headphone models across numerous price ranges.
Aspects Influencing Headphone Prices
Several key factors affect the price of headphones, which include:
1. Type of Headphones
- Over-Ear: Known for their convenience and sound quality, over-ear headphones generally vary from mid to high price points.
- On-Ear: These offer a more portable option and typically sit at a lower price compared to over-ear alternatives.
- In-Ear: Also understood as earphones, these are usually more affordable, but high-end models can be costly.
- True Wireless: TWS headphones have gotten popularity for their convenience but can differ considerably in cost.
2. Brand name Reputation
- Brand names like Bose and Sennheiser command greater rates due to their established reputation and quality assurance, while lesser-known brands might offer more economical alternatives without substantial brand support.
3. Sound Quality
- Headphones with much better chauffeurs and advanced sound technologies, such as noise cancellation or adaptive noise settings, come at a premium price.
4. Material and Build Quality
- Headphones made from long lasting products like metal and top quality plastics are typically more expensive due to the increased production cost.
5. Functions
- Wired vs. Wireless: Wireless headphones often cost more due to Bluetooth innovation and battery management systems.
- Sound Cancellation: Active sound cancellation technology substantially increases the price of headphones.
- Microphone Quality: Integrated top quality microphones enhance functionality, especially for gamers and experts, resulting in a higher price tag.
6. Target Audience
- Headphones created for audiophiles or expert studio use usually fall within a greater price bracket due to accuracy engineering and premium products.
Headphones Pricing Tiers
When shopping for headphones, it can be beneficial to classify them into unique prices tiers. Below is a breakdown of pricing tiers and examples of popular headphone designs in each classification.
Price Range | Description | Example Models |
---|---|---|
Budget (<<₤ 50)Basic features, decent quality, appropriate for casual usage. | Anker SoundCore, JLab Audio | |
Mid-range (₤ 50 - ₤ 150) | Balanced sound quality, more comfort, extra features like sound seclusion. | Sony WH-CH710N, Apple AirPods |
High-end (₤ 150 - ₤ 300) | Superior sound quality, excellent develop quality, features like sound cancellation. | Bose QuietComfort 35 II, Sennheiser HD 558 |
Audiophile (₤ 300+) | Exceptional audio fidelity, frequently including high-end materials and technologies. | Audeze LCD-X, Focal Stellia |
Move Beyond Price Tags: An In-depth Comparison
For consumers considering their headphone purchase beyond just price, understanding the benefits and potential downsides of each classification is essential. Here's how they compare to one another:
Budget Headphones
- Pros: Affordable, decent sound quality for daily jobs, light-weight.
- Cons: Durability issues, restricted functions, poorer sound quality compared to more costly models.
Mid-range Headphones
- Pros: Great balance of price and efficiency, additional features like better cushioning and sound isolation.
- Cons: May still do not have the sound quality of higher-end choices.
High-End Headphones
- Pros: Outstanding sound quality, high comfort levels, versatile features like noise cancellation.
- Cons: Price can be prohibitively high for casual listeners.
Audiophile
- Pros: Exceptional sound recreation, premium materials, focused on creating an immersive listening experience.
- Cons: Not appropriate for casual listeners due to high price; might need additional amplifications.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Why are some headphones so pricey?
Pricey headphones typically include top quality materials, advanced technologies, exceptional noise engineering, and reliable brand backing. Audiophiles and specialists might discover these features worth the financial investment.
2. Are cheaper headphones worth purchasing?
More affordable headphones can be a good choice for casual users or those just starting with headphones. They frequently offer decent sound quality for daily usage however may do not have resilience and advanced functions.
3. Do I require sound cancellation for regular usage?
If you frequently discover yourself in loud environments or commute regularly, sound cancellation can boost your listening experience. Nevertheless, if you normally utilize headphones in quieter settings, it may not be required.
